CCP device (drivers/crypto/ccp/ccp.ko) is part of AMD Secure Processor,
which is not dedicated solely to crypto. The AMD Secure Processor includes
CCP and PSP (Platform Secure Processor) devices.

This patch series adds a framework that allows functional component of the
AMD Secure Processor to be initialized and handled appropriately. The series
does not makes any logic modification into CCP - it refactors the code to
integerate CCP into AMD secure processor framework.

The CCP and PSP devices part of AMD Secure Procesor may share the same
interrupt. Hence we expand the SP device to register a common interrupt
handler and provide functions to CCP and PSP devices to register their
interrupt callback which will be invoked upon interrupt.
